Job Overview
TXT Novigo, a leader in IT services for the financial market and part of the TXT Group, is seeking a Project Manager. The role involves interacting with Business and IT functions both internally and with clients, coordinating development, implementation, and evolution of our software products and custom applications.
Responsibilities
Serve as the internal and client reference point for end-to-end project management.
Analyze, document, and validate client requirements, translating them into functional specifications for product development.
Define and monitor project timelines and methods in collaboration with the Technical Leader.
Manage use case definitions, testing scenarios, and support User Acceptance/Business Tests.
Contribute to proposals, feasibility studies, and new business opportunities.
Required Skills
At least 5 years of experience in a similar role within fintech companies.
Good knowledge of banking and financial sector processes.
Proven experience in team management and activity planning and monitoring.
Goal-oriented with strong analytical and synthesis skills.
Knowledge of Agile and Waterfall methodologies.
Excellent communication skills.
Good command of English language.
Optional Skills
Specific knowledge of credit management processes and products.
Familiarity with process modeling tools and organization.
Knowledge of AS400.
Ability to query databases and manage SQL queries.
